Picture gallery: Intertwining in the capital as emphasis is put on integration

Last night ”new” and ”native” Faroe Islanders met at the Municipal Library in downtown Tórshavn as the event ”Sambinding” (Intertwining) took place – an event dedicated to mingling, talking and just having a nice time.

The evening started at 7 pm with a Faroese language course for beginners, and then Sharon Christiansen, originally from India, explained how she survived her first years in the Faroe Islands.

The aim of ”Sambinding” is to improve integration and the meeting between ”new” and ”native” Faroe Islanders.

“Sambinding” has been running on a monthly basis since 2016.

The next couple of intertwining events are scheduled for 6 March, 10 April, 8 May and 5 June.
